GO Term : GO:0010292 GTP:GDP antiporter activity GO

Namespace  molecular_function Obsolete  false
description  Catalysis of the reaction: GTP(out) + GDP(in) = GTP(in) + GDP(out).

Identifier Name Description
GO:0015297 antiporter activity Enables the active transport of a solute across a membrane by a mechanism whereby two or more species are transported in opposite directions in a tightly coupled process not directly linked to a form of energy other than chemiosmotic energy. The reaction is: solute A(out) + solute B(in) = solute A(in) + solute B(out).
GO:0022857 transmembrane transporter activity Enables the transfer of a substance from one side of a membrane to the other.
GO:0022891 substrate-specific transmembrane transporter activity Enables the transfer of a specific substance or group of related substances from one side of a membrane to the other.
GO:0005215 transporter activity Enables the directed movement of substances (such as macromolecules, small molecules, ions) into, out of or within a cell, or between cells.
GO:0005337 nucleoside transmembrane transporter activity Enables the transfer of a nucleoside, a nucleobase linked to either beta-D-ribofuranose (ribonucleoside) or 2-deoxy-beta-D-ribofuranose, (a deoxyribonucleotide) from one side of a membrane to the other.
GO:0015075 ion transmembrane transporter activity Enables the transfer of an ion from one side of a membrane to the other.
GO:0003674 molecular_function Elemental activities, such as catalysis or binding, describing the actions of a gene product at the molecular level. A given gene product may exhibit one or more molecular functions.
GO:0022892 substrate-specific transporter activity Enables the directed movement of a specific substance or group of related substances (such as macromolecules, small molecules, ions) into, out of or within a cell, or between cells.
GO:0008514 organic anion transmembrane transporter activity Enables the transfer of organic anions from one side of a membrane to the other. Organic anions are atoms or small molecules with a negative charge which contain carbon in covalent linkage.
GO:0008509 anion transmembrane transporter activity Enables the transfer of a negatively charged ion from one side of a membrane to the other.
GO:0015211 purine nucleoside transmembrane transporter activity Enables the transfer of a purine nucleoside, a purine base covalently bonded to a ribose or deoxyribose sugar, from one side of a membrane to the other.
GO:0015932 nucleobase-containing compound transmembrane transporter activity Enables the transfer of nucleobases, nucleosides, nucleotides and nucleic acids from one side of a membrane to the other.
GO:1901505 carbohydrate derivative transporter activity Enables the directed movement of carbohydrate derivative into, out of or within a cell, or between cells.
GO:0022804 active transmembrane transporter activity Catalysis of the transfer of a specific substance or related group of substances from one side of a membrane to the other, up the solute's concentration gradient. The transporter binds the solute and undergoes a series of conformational changes. Transport works equally well in either direction.
GO:0015291 secondary active transmembrane transporter activity Catalysis of the transfer of a solute from one side of a membrane to the other, up its concentration gradient. The transporter binds the solute and undergoes a series of conformational changes. Transport works equally well in either direction and is driven by a chemiosmotic source of energy, not direct ATP coupling. Chemiosmotic sources of energy include uniport, symport or antiport.
GO:0015216 purine nucleotide transmembrane transporter activity Enables the transfer of a purine nucleotide, any compound consisting of a purine nucleoside esterified with (ortho)phosphate, from one side of a membrane to the other.
GO:0015605 organophosphate ester transmembrane transporter activity Enables the transfer of organophosphate esters from one side of a membrane to the other. Organophosphate esters are small organic molecules containing phosphate ester bonds.
GO:1901677 phosphate transmembrane transporter activity Enables the transfer of phosphate from one side of the membrane to the other.
GO:0015215 nucleotide transmembrane transporter activity Enables the transfer of a nucleotide, any compound consisting of a nucleoside that is esterified with (ortho)phosphate, from one side of a membrane to the other.
GO:0001409 guanine nucleotide transmembrane transporter activity Catalysis of the transfer of guanine nucleotides (GMP, GDP, and GTP) from one side of the membrane to the other.
GO:0005346 purine ribonucleotide transmembrane transporter activity Enables the transfer of a purine ribonucleotide, any compound consisting of a purine ribonucleoside (a purine organic base attached to a ribose sugar) esterified with (ortho)phosphate, from one side of a membrane to the other.
GO:0015301 anion:anion antiporter activity Catalysis of the transfer of a solute or solutes from one side of a membrane to the other according to the reaction: anion A(out) + anion B(in) = anion A(in) + anion B(out).
GO:0010292 GTP:GDP antiporter activity Catalysis of the reaction: GTP(out) + GDP(in) = GTP(in) + GDP(out).
